Sanford, A Division of Newell-Rubbermaid, and Insight Product Development Receive 'User Centered Product Design' Award by the Human Factors Ergonomic Society
December 9, 2005 – Insight Product Development, a world-class developer of award-winning products, announced today that the Expo© dry eraser marker developed in collaboration with Sanford, a global leader in writing instruments received the User Centered Product Design Award by the Human Factors Ergonomic Society (HFES).
"We're pleased to be recognized," commented Phil Dolci, vice president and general manager of Expo©. "This award is a true reflection of how the research, design, and engineering all worked together to redefine the dry erase marker experience for work, home and play." The Expo dry erase marker and eraser system designed by Insight is the first ever to support writing on a vertical surface. The new marker also includes the first ever built-in replaceable eraser - making it easier for people to quickly erase with more precision. The markers feature a one-of-a-kind grip and contoured barrel as well as a gripped cap for easy capping and uncapping.
"We changed the way people use dry erase markers as a way to communicate," commented Ed Geiselhart, senior manager of design at Insight PD. "We took the guess work out of identifying the color of the marker, added a grip cap that reduced the likelihood of people getting ink on their fingers, improved the shape and contour, and gave people instant access and storage by developing an on-the-board docking station for their markers, erasers and board cleaner.".
In addition to designing the dry erase marker, Insight also designed two erasers that provide 'peel away' surfaces that reduce the likelihood of people using dirty erasers that fail to clean well. The larger eraser is designed for users who use white boards extensively and typically need to erase the entire board on a repeated basis such as educators, while the smaller eraser which comes with an attached cleaning spray bottle is ideal for wiping an area or section of the board without losing the ability to retain areas that don't require erasing.
To overcome the frustration of misplaced dry erase markers and erasers, Insight developed an on-the-board docking station for both the markers and the erasers that can be placed anywhere on the board. About Expo©
One of Sanford's most popular brands, Expo© is the leader in dry erase markers, accessories and white board surfaces. Sanford, a business of Newell Rubbermaid Inc., is a worldwide leader in the manufacturing and marketing of writing instruments, art products and office organization, including such well known brands as Paper Mate©, Sharpie©, Parker©, Waterman©, Foohy©, uni-ball© and Rolodex©, among others. Sanford makes more than 6,000 products, ranging from markers, pens and pencils to professional art products, fine writing instruments and office organization products. The Human Factors Ergonomics Society (HFES)
The Society's mission is to promote the discovery and exchange of knowledge concerning the characteristics of human beings that are applicable to the design of systems and devices of all kinds.
